/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} ArabsWin recreations gambling inside Bahrain guide is just what you’re appearing to own

ArabsWin recreations gambling inside Bahrain guide is just what you’re appearing to own

Fresh to recreations playing in Bahrain? Do you wish to initiate now? Then you are on the best source for information! This guide will cover seriously everything you need to understand to help you become an expert. Getting to grips with wagering isn't very difficult, you can select one of our own necessary activities gaming sites inside Bahrain and go after our very own suggestions to put your first effective choice.

Popular Activities Playing Internet sites during the Bahrain

Even though there is thousands of providers away from activities betting from inside the Bahrain online, in Bahrain just six company out of sports gaming within the Bahrain is controling the newest ely:

YYYSport

Throughout our search, i discover YYYSport are the greatest-high quality sportsbook. It offers over one,000 betting locations daily with the common commission off +95%. Simultaneously, brand new gaming website even offers the novices a couple invited incentives to determine of. Loyal people can also rating a variety of incentives and you can advantages.

1xbet

1xBet is without question the greatest leader on the Bitcoin football playing bling webpages is within organization just like the 2007. During the past fifteen years, it was able to acquire fame certainly bettors from around the new industry. The new Russian bookie also provides sports gambling locations together with more than sixty other sports. 1xBet helps Arabic, English, and you can French it is therefore an educated place to go for the Bahraini bettors.

Betfinal

With respect to cheap and you will punctual profits, Betfinal is the better options. The brand new betting web site helps Charge, Charge gala bingo card, Skrill, MuchBetter, Bitcoin, Litecoin, Ethereun, USDT, and even more. The minimum deposit right here initiate of $ten, because the restriction number goes up to help you $5,000.

Rabona

The following is you to definitely Rabona, of all the sports betting web sites on the web, provides the finest incentives and you may advertising for its people. Here, punters may over sixty incentives being more enough to score a captivating and less-risky gaming sense. In addition to, Rabona shines for its support regarding an extended list of payment steps that come with financial notes, e-wallets, and cryptocurrency.

Betway

In the world of virtual sporting events, Betway also offers one of the best offerings. Right here there can be a complete listing of playing locations, as well as currency line, 1?2, impairment, ACCA wagers, and many more. And, you may enjoy the newest 100 % free online streaming services for everyone digital football.

Betobet

Betobet also provides one of the recommended software for smartphones, and is also compatible with each other apple's ios and you can Android. New gambling operator even offers of several incentives and ongoing offers for dedicated people. The latest activities gambling webpages stands out regarding race using its easy-to-have fun with system, seamless cellular type, and steeped gaming industry choices.

ZodiacBet

If you're looking for the best mobile sportsbook, take a look at ZodiacBet. Brand new well-known betting website works with each other Android and ios gizmos and will be offering many bonuses to own mobile pages. Whether it is not sufficient for your playing hobbies, you should buy of numerous bonuses that stretch their gambling lessons and permit you to receive significantly more winnings.

Betwinner

Betwinner is renowned for the different recreations it talks about and you may now offers a wide range of betting markets. It bookmaker is quite the same as 1xbet and Melbet, so you anticipate the same directory of possess detailed with an effort program, seamless routing, a wide range of incentives, and you can competitive gambling avenues. Recreations 's the undisputed king here as it regulation the brand new lion's show regarding coverage, incentives, and playing locations.

Shangri-la

The following sportsbook supplies the handiest percentage solutions to its people. Here, you are able to use any kind of banking provider to cope with your bankroll, in addition to banking cards, e-purses, and you will cryptocurrency. The new bookmaker also offers its users competitive chances, and you will good incentives, which can be suitable for all of the smartphones.